Uncle Dear:
Author: Meridian Zuriel

vinebar

You say you love me
But yet you fail to show some sign
You say you care for me
But your words aren’t worth a dime
I need to see some action
I need to feel compassion
Don’t just tell me what I want to hear
Prove to me that you’re really sincere

We only see each other once or twice a year
It shouldn’t take a funeral or a holiday, to bring us near
Christmas is approaching; so let’s have good cheer
Though you’re my uncle, it still feels a little weird
You’re family, but yet you seem like a stranger
Our relationship has already been endangered
You’re always on-the-go, when all of us come to visit you
Every time we come home, you only stay for a minute or two

Let this upcoming New Year be a new beginning for us
Let the old things burn up, while the new things develop
Let us be much closer than what we used to be
Please open your ears and listen to your only niece
I love you, but I don’t have time to voice the words
You’re always leaving, so how will I ever be heard?
So, when I come visit you and grandma, please say you’ll stay awhile
Let’s not only make this holiday worthwhile, but let’s end it in smiles

I’m tired of frowning every Christmas!
